NexPoint Residential Trust Inc is a real estate investment trust company. The trust's objectives are to maximize the cash flow and value of properties owned, acquire properties with cash flow growth potential, provide quarterly cash distributions, and achieve long-term capital appreciation for stockholders. It focuses on acquiring multifamily properties in markets with attractive job growth and household formation fundamentals predominantly in the Southeastern and Southwestern United States. The company generates revenue from the rental of multifamily properties.

NXRT Recaps Value-Add Results, Tames Expense Growth and Pays Down $33.0 Million on Credit Facility
Dallas, TX, April 28, 2026 – NexPoint Residential Trust, Inc. (NYSE:NXRT) reported financ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2026.
Highlights
• NXRT1 reported net loss, FFO2, Core FFO2 and AFFO2 of $6.8M, $17.4M, $17.3M and $19.6M, respectively, attributable to common stockholders for the quarter ended March 31, 2026, compared to net loss, FFO, Core FFO, and AFFO of $6.9M, $17.4M, $19.1M and $21.6M, respectively, attributable to common stockholders for the quarter ended March 31, 2025.
• For the three months ended March 31, 2026, Q1 Same Store properties3 total revenue, NOI2 , average effective rent, and occupancy decreased 2.2%, 2.7%, 0.9% and 80 bps, respectively, over the prior year period.
• The weighted average effective monthly rent per unit across all 36 properties held as of March 31, 2026 (the “Portfolio”), consisting of 13,304 units4, was $1,485, while physical occupancy was 93.5%.
• NXRT paid a first quarter dividend of $0.53 per share of common stock on March 31, 2026 to stockholders of record on March 13, 2026.
• On February 3, 2026, NXRT used proceeds from a new mortgage note secured by Sedona at Lone Mountain to pay down $33.0 million of its outstanding principal balance on the Credit Facility.
• During the first quarter, for the properties in the Portfolio, NXRT completed 300 full and partial upgrades, leased 225 upgraded units, achieving an average monthly rent premium of $69 and a 19.0% ROI5.
• Since inception, NXRT has completed installation of 10,118 full and partial upgrades, 5,027 kitchen and laundry appliances and 11,199 technology packages, resulting in $155, $51 and $43 average monthly rental increase per unit and 20.7%, 63.5% and 37.2% ROI, respectively.
(1) In this release, “we,” “us,” “our,” the “Company,” and “NXRT” each refer to NexPoint Residential Trust, Inc., a Maryland corporation.
(2) FFO, Core FFO, AFFO and NOI are non-GAAP measures. For a discussion of why we consider these non-GAAP measures useful and reconciliations of FFO, Core FFO, AFFO and NOI to net income (loss), see the “Definitions and Reconciliations of Non-GAAP Measures” and “FFO, Core FFO and AFFO” sections of this release.
(3) We define “Same Store” properties as properties that were in our Portfolio for the entirety of the periods being compared. There are 35 properties encompassing 12,984 units of apartment space in our Same Store pool for the three months ended March 31, 2026 (our “Q1 Same Store” properties).
(4) Total number of units owned as of March 31, 2026 is 13,305, however 1 unit is currently down.
(5) We define Return on Investment (“ROI”) as the sum of the actual 12-month rent premium divided by the sum of the total cost.

First Quarter 2026 Financial Results
• Total revenues were $63.5 million for the first quarter of 2026, compared to $63.2 million for the first quarter of 2025.
• Net loss attributable to common stockholders for the first quarter of 2026 totaled $6.8 million, or loss of $0.27 per diluted share. This compared to net loss attributable to common stockholders of $6.9 million, or loss of $0.27 per diluted share for the first quarter of 2025.
